CONTRACT SIGNEDEnjoy breathtaking views and light in this high floor one bedroom. The living room, kitchen and bedroom all provide open southern views of all lower Manhattan. The layout features an entry foyer, well proportioned rooms, a windowed kitchen and original hardwood parquet floors. On the boundary of Soho and the West Village, the building is located at the intersection of Bedford and West Houston. The coop allows pied-a-terres; co-purchasing, gifting and guarantors; washer/dryers; and pets. The building has excellent financials and low monthly maintenance. Breen Towers is a well established coop with live-in resident manager, part-time doorman, laundry room, bike and common storage rooms. Close to the C/E subway lines at Spring Street, a block from the #1 on Houston Street and a short distance to the B/D/F/M at West 4th Street.
